Event Operations Manager The Event Operations Manager is responsible for managing the operational aspects of events. Key responsibilities include: • Managing event requisitions, including wares, equipment, and deliverables; • Executing event delivery, including pack out, load out, set up, and strike; • Managing event service staff; • Maintaining accurate inventories of company-owned wares and equipment; • Scheduling routine cleaning and maintenance of the event venue. The Event Operations Manager must also develop and maintain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) related to event operations, adhere to laws and regulations regarding safety and sanitation, and work collaboratively with other departments as needed. Key Responsibilities: • Verify, confirm, approve, and fulfill incoming event equipment, wares, vendor, staffing, deliverables, and transportation requisitions; • Direct event pack outs, load outs, set ups, strikes, and load ins for all events; • Develop and manage event timelines and deliverables schedules; • Serve as on- and off-site Event Service Lead for events as needed; • Facilitate facilities management, including building maintenance, cleaning, equipment and wares inventory, and vehicle outfitting and service; • Hire, train, schedule, and direct Front of House Events Service Staff, including Leads, Servers, Bartenders, Event Supports, and Porters; • Collaborate with Events Sales and Planner in event development, scheduling, vendor, and venue logistics; • Perform any other duties assigned by the manager.
